"Help Yourself!" is an engaging exploration of personality and character analysis designed to provoke self-reflection and spark lively social interaction. In an era fascinated by the burgeoning field of psychology, this work offers a series of insightful questions and interactive tests intended to reveal the hidden traits and tendencies of the reader and their companions.

The book functions as both a guide for personal growth and a sophisticated social tool, inviting participants to delve into their motivations, preferences, and temperaments. Doris Webster's approach transforms the study of the self into a shared experience of discovery, blending wit with psychological observation. Whether used for individual introspection or as a catalyst for group discussion, "Help Yourself!" captures the vibrant spirit of the late 1920s interest in human behavior and the desire for self-knowledge. Its structured inquiries provide a unique window into how individuals navigated their identities and social roles during a transformative period in modern history, making it a fascinating artifact of early 20th-century popular psychology.
